A New Malbec from Uco Valley to Discover

Familia Deicas crosses borders once again to present Valle de Uco Malbec, a vibrant expression of the iconic Mendocino terroir, furthering its exploration of Argentina’s most renowned vineyards.

For years, Bodega Familia Deicas has been expanding its horizons, passionately exploring the region’s most prestigious terroirs. Their journey in Mendoza began in Perdriel, Luján de Cuyo, birthplace of some of Argentina’s most celebrated Malbec wines.

Today, our winery takes a new step towards the Valle de Uco, a place where altitude and climate create ideal conditions for wines with natural freshness, great concentration, and unmistakable elegance.

“We feel deeply inspired by Mendoza’s great terroirs. After working with Perdriel, moving into Valle de Uco was a natural choice to continue interpreting Malbec through our unique vision,” explains Santiago Deicas, winemaker at Familia Deicas.

The Soul of Valle de Uco in Every Glass

The vineyards of Valle de Uco sit between 1,000 and 1,250 meters above sea level. This altitude ensures moderate daytime temperatures and cool nights, extending the ripening cycle and preserving the grape’s natural acidity.

The new Familia Deicas Valle de Uco Malbec is crafted with extended maceration to extract maximum fruit expression and structure. It is partially aged in second-use French oak barrels, adding complexity while preserving the fruit’s fresh character.

The result: a wine of deep red color, with intense aromas of black fruits like blackberries and plums, subtle floral notes, and elegant hints of spices and vanilla. On the palate, it is juicy, with silky tannins and a long, lingering finish that invites you to keep discovering every sip.

“We’ve always been inspired by the oceanic influence in our Uruguayan wines, and when we arrived in Valle de Uco, we found a high-altitude climate offering similar freshness but with its own unique personality,” says Santiago Deicas. “Our goal is to capture that vibrant energy, with intense fruit expression and silky tannins, crafting a Malbec that remains true to the character of Valle de Uco and to the philosophy of Familia Deicas.”
